Title 20 › Chapter CHAPTER 28— - HIGHER EDUCATION RESOURCES AND STUDENT ASSISTANCE › Subchapter SUBCHAPTER IV— - STUDENT ASSISTANCE › Part Part A— - Grants to Students in Attendance at Institutions of Higher Education › Subpart subpart 6— - robert c. byrd honors scholarship program › § 1070d–38
Each scholarship recipient gets a $1,500 stipend for the academic year, but total aid cannot exceed the student’s cost of attendance. The State educational agency must make rules to ensure scholars enroll at a higher-education institution.
